Bahrain to host key forum

Manama, Nov. 30 (BNA): Bahrain is set to host the 3rd Arab forum on prospects of generating electricity and desalinating sea water with nuclear energy. The event will kick off on Tuesday (December 1) and continue till Thursday (December 3) at the Diplomat Hotel. It is organised by the Supreme Council for Environment (SCE) and the Electricity and Water Authority (EWA) in cooperation with the Arab Atomic Energy Agency (AAEA), the General Secretariat of the Arab League's Arab Ministerial Council for Electricity and the Arab Union of Electricity and with the support of the Gulf Petrochemical Industries Company (GPIC). Marking the occasion, SCE Chief Executive Dr. Mohammed Mubarak bin Daina said ever since Bahrain became member of the AAEA in 2009, SCE has shown keenness as an official monitoring authority to issue resolutions concerning radioactive substances in cooperation with AAEA so as to curb their harmful effects on people's health and the environment. The forum is considered as an opportunity to debate previously-raised issues pertaining to priorities and fears related to nuclear power programmes in Arab countries. The event will bring together experts from and officials from AAEA member states, the International Atomic Energy Agency and related institutions in the USA, Russia and China.
